How do I put the spring back into my computer mouse?

If you ever open a computer mouse with a scroll wheel, there is a possibility that the spring that supports the scroll wheel will fall out. That can be frustrating and confusing. Usually, the coil part of the spring goes on the shaft of the mouse wheel. Often, the shaft is longer on that side to make room for the spring. There should be places for the projections to go on the same side as the longer part of the shaft goes. It may take a bit of trial and error until you figure it out.

How do you use tabbed browsing in Mozilla Firefox?

Tabs are a way to have multiple web-pages running at the same time. In Mozilla Firefox, to create a new tab, press ctrl+t. That will open a new tab in which you can open another website. File, NEW TAB If you click a link by pressing down on the scroll wheel on your mouse it will open a new tab, tabs appear below the bookmarks toolbar.
